On Friday, Piedra Vista faced Lovington in a battle between two of the state's top teams. The Piedra Vista Panthers came out on top in a nail-biter against the Lovington Wildcats, sneaking past 3-1.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Panthers.
ISABELLA JESSEE was excellent, going 2-for-4 with two RBI and one double.

Piedra Vista pushed their record up to 2-0 with the win, which was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season. They've dominated over that stretch too, winning by an average of 12 runs. As for Lovington, their defeat ended a 12-game streak of away wins dating back to last season and brought them to 2-1.
Piedra Vista has already played their next game, a 9-1 loss against Centennial on the 7th. As for Lovington, they also w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next contest, a 9-4 defeat against Silver on the 7th.
